Monster 3-HR Day for Jones
Friday, April 26th , 2047
Fans are still buzzing after Baxter whipped the Arlington Trappers by the score of 10-0 at Trappers Ballpark.
John Jones smashed three home runs in the contest, a feat that would be a career highlight for most players and few fans ever see. In a tremendous performance, the second baseman bashed out 3 hits in 5 at-bats, had 5 RBIs and scored 3 times.
At the postgame press conference, Jones said it was an "unbelievable" feeling to hit three home runs in a game.
"Getting one homer is special, and two is great," Jones said. "Three is just... wow."
John Jones hit a solo-shot off Ryan Rivers in the 1st, grounded out in the 3rd, hit a solo-shot off Ben Hale in the 5th, grounded out in the 7th and hit a three-run home run off Mike Foust in the 9th.
To date this season, Jones is hitting .157 with 3 home runs.
